Amadeus heralds sustainability with new Amara vessel for 2025

Amadeus River Cruises has announced details of its latest and most sustainable ship, Amadeus Amara, which will join the fleet in July next year.

Thanks to an innovative lightweight construction and a shallow draft in this category of ships, the vessel will remain reliably operational even in seasonally fluctuating water levels.

Its reduced water resistance will also help minimise fuel consumption. The sustainable design is further enhanced by an efficient hull shape, a fuel-saving autopilot and solar panels on the sun deck, all of which contribute to environmentally friendly river cruising.
